i disabled my Commands and enabled the "stock" FOTRSU Commands (ver 1/25/20 12:35) and restarted the mission.
the non-recharge issue is not Commands related as the performance is the same: no battery recharge.

also, during the mission, i turned off the Propulsion_Recharge using the Menu and then turned it on again. Made no difference in performance.

so...what else can affect recharging the batteries? what other files are involved? i would think that that functionality is "behind the Ubi curtain".
anything in the Sub files (sim,zon,upc,cfg)?

p.s. Remember when i did that series of tests on battery recharging with various boats at various speeds? just like others?
well....we were not testing for all of the factors. we might still not test for all of the factors but i discovered another factor in battery recharging: Submerged Range in the Sim file has a significant effect on recharging.

i will have to set up some tests to see the effect of the two variables on both endurance range and recharging time but i can definitely state that a high value in the Submerged Range can basically guarantee that you will not be able to recharge the batteries and conversely, setting the Range to a low number will enable the batteries to re-charge ever-so-quickly.
